CDM Smith is seeking a Geospatial Technology Leader to join our Digital Engineering Solutions team. This individual will lead the Geospatial Technology group within the Digital Engineering Solutions team, helping to drive strategic architecture, engineering and construction (AEC) initiatives through advances in GIS and mapping technologies, reality capture, remote sensing, the internet of things (IoT) / sensors, and custom solutions and workflows for AEC professionals. The Geospatial Technology group will lead the firm in best practices for these types of technologies, helping to set the CDM Smith Way for our AEC design, planning, and construction practices, while also keeping the firm ahead of the curve with new and emerging technologies in this space, including the geospatial technology elements of digital twins. This position is for a person who has demonstrated leadership capabilities, is business savvy, experienced with geospatial technologies for the AEC industry, and enjoys framing a problem, shaping and creating solutions, and helping to lead and champion implementation. As a member of the Digital Engineering Solutions team, the Geospatial Technology group will also engage in research and development and provide guidance and oversight to the AEC practices at CDM Smith, engaging in new product research, testing, and the incubation of innovative ideas that arise from around the company.

The ideal candidate will have a proven record as a team leader and expert in the field of AEC geospatial technology, with a mindset of continuous learning and curiosity leading to tangible results.
